Wilder Child Development Center, a full-time early learning program in Saint Paul, provides an enriching, high-quality educational experience for children age 16 months to 5 years. The CDC offers parents whose children attend the center additional support services and referrals to foster family wellbeing. To understand the experience and impact of the Family Services on families, Wilder Research surveyed parents about the direct supports and referrals they received, the helpfulness of those supports and referrals, and their impact on family stability and wellbeing. Results show that parents are utilizing the supports and referrals offered through the CDC, particularly those related to childcare assistance, and find them helpful.
